Myopia Control in Edmonton

Myopia, also known as nearsightedness, is a common refractive error where distant objects appear blurry, while close-up objects are seen clearly. It happens when the eye is too long or the cornea is too curved, causing light to focus in front of the retina instead of directly on it. Myopia typically starts in childhood and can progress throughout the teen years and into early adulthood.

Myopia Control Treatment Options

At Optometrists’ Clinic Inc., we offer several advanced strategies to help slow the progression of myopia in children and young adults. Our goal is to protect long-term eye health and reduce the risk of future vision complications.

Therapeutic Myopia Control Contact Lenses

Specially designed soft contact lenses create a specific focus pattern on the retina that has been clinically proven to reduce the progression of myopia in children.

Orthokeratology (Ortho-K)

These overnight lenses gently reshape the cornea while your child sleeps, providing clear vision during the day without glasses or contacts—and helping control myopia progression.

Low-Dose Atropine Eye Drops

A low-concentration medicated eye drop used once nightly that has shown to slow myopia progression in children with minimal side effects.

Myopia Control Eyeglass Lenses

Special eyeglass lenses, such as Stellest™ or MiyoSmart, are designed with multiple focus zones that help manage the way light is focused on the retina to slow myopia development.

Lifestyle and Environmental Recommendations

We provide guidance on increasing outdoor time, managing screen use, and adjusting near work habits, all of which can play a role in controlling myopia.
